Send a Mail/Package

Inmates can send and receive mails and packages while at the Massillon city Jail. Still, this correspondence must pass through a Massillon Police Department detention officer for checking and approval.

Sending Money

You can deposit cash in person at the Massillon Police Department’s self-service kiosks. Second, the Massillon Police Department has an online deposit option whereby you have to register and top up an inmate’s commissary account. Indicate the inmate’s full names and inmate Ohio ID at the back of the money order. Call the Massillon city Police Department administration at 330-830-1762 for further clarification. 

Phone Calls

Inmates at Massillon city Jail can make free telephone calls to their friends and family members as they go through the booking process at Massillon Police Department. Afterward, they have to provide to Massillon Police Department a list of persons they want to call for approval. It is a 26 minutes call that reduces to 14 minutes during rush hours. 

Visitation Rules

Inmates at the Massillon city Jail can have 3 visits from not more than 2 visitors per day. These are 24-minutes visiting sessions from 2 pm to 4 pm each day. Still, the inmate at the Massillon Police Department can get a visit from an attorney, bondsman, or clergy at any time. Call the Massillon Police Department at 330-830-1762 to arrange for the visit.
